I couldn’t wait to pull out these floral overalls that I’ve had in my closet for a couple months. I bought them at Tilly’s and couldn’t wait till it got a little warmer so I could wear them. They were having a 50% off their sale items so I ended up only spending $7.00 for them! I love that these overalls are a cross between a lightweight floral jumper and overalls. I’m also in love with the cute criss-cross straps in the back. The loose fitted, lightweight, dark floral fabric paired with a basic black tank make for a perfect transition into Spring look. I am wearing my floral overalls with my black H&M hat, my thrifted black boots, and my silver Aztec necklace from Forever 21.
